OES Equipment, part of the DPR Family of Companies, is a fast-paced supply and rental equipment company in the construction industry seeking a motivated Procurement Representative to assist our OES Specialties division (Division 10, 11 and 12). They will support procurement and project delivery activities by coordinating supplier research, purchase order processing, order tracking, and documentation workflows. They will produce procurement documentation such as product data, lead times and order confirmations to support stakeholder requirements.
The Procurement Representative will also monitor delivery status, verify received items, and support resolution of procurement issues. They will maintain procurement records and support basic financial tracking to ensure data accuracy and timely reporting. Responsibilities will include but may not be limited to the following:
Duties and Responsibilities
Research suppliers and support sourcing of goods and services to meet project and operational requirements.
Prepare and coordinate product data and related documentation in alignment with project needs.
Create and process detailed purchase orders and reviews order acknowledgements to validate quantities, pricing, and delivery terms.
Place and track orders, confirm estimated delivery dates, and communicate status updates to internal stakeholders.
Verify delivered items and support resolution of discrepancies related to receiving, quality, or documentation.
Create submittals and review Acknowledged Orders.
Partner with estimating and project stakeholders to develop pricing, prepare material proposals, and support competitive bid responses for procurement scopes.
Work with our Estimator to gather pricing on large projects.
Support tracking and reconciliation of procurement documentation and basic financial data to maintain accurate records.
Collect, track, and correct division finances.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ene
Key Facts About Boston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
-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
